您可以把这个 FLASH 理解成您电脑的 硬盘 或 固态硬盘(SSD)。
在H3C交换机中,FLASH是一种非易失性存储芯片,主要用于存放:
设备操作系统(Comware软件):也就是交换机运行的核心程序文件(.bin
文件)。
启动配置文件(startup.cfg):您通过 save
命令保存的设备配置就存储在这里,设备重启后会读取这个文件。
日志文件(.log文件):系统运行过程中产生的各种日志文件。
备份文件、Web管理页面文件等:可能还包括一些备份的配置或系统文件。
您在产品界面看到的 “FLASH”,指的就是这块内置存储芯片的容量和使用情况。
结论:基本不会影响性能。
不影响数据转发(关键):交换机的数据转发(交换和路由性能)是由专用的ASIC硬件芯片完成的,这个过程不依赖于FLASH的读写速度。只要系统能正常启动并加载配置到内存中,后续的数据包转发全由硬件处理,FLASH的占用率高低对此没有影响。
类似电脑的原理:就像您的电脑,操作系统和软件一旦从硬盘加载到内存中运行后,硬盘的剩余空间大小通常不会直接影响CPU的计算速度和内存的运行效率。
但是,需要注意以下几点:
空间不足的风险:虽然79%是正常的,但如果占用率持续增长(例如超过90%),就需要引起注意。空间严重不足可能会导致:
无法保存配置:执行 save
命令时可能失败。
无法升级系统:没有足够的空间存放新的系统软件文件。
日志无法写入:可能影响故障排查。
写操作频繁时:如果在极短时间内进行大量需要写入FLASH的操作(例如持续输出非常详细的调试日志),理论上可能会轻微增加CPU负担,但这种场景极其罕见,对日常使用无感知。
H3C交换机的FLASH容量本身就不大(通常为32MB或64MB),系统软件文件本身就会占用大部分空间。79%的占用率说明设备已经稳定运行了一段时间,积累了一些日志文件,这是非常普遍的情况。
您可以自行检查一下文件内容,决定是否清理:
# 查看FLASH根目录下的文件列表
dir
# 查看logfile文件夹下的内容(日志文件通常在这里)
dir logfile
可以安全删除的文件(请在删除前确认):
旧的系统软件文件:如果您多次升级过系统,FLASH里可能会有多个旧的.bin
文件(例如 s5500_52g3-cmw520-r1109.bin
, s5500_52g3-cmw520-r2211.bin
),只保留当前正在运行和一个最新备用的版本即可,其他的可以删除。
# 删除命令示例 (务必谨慎,确认文件名无误!)
delete /unreserved flash:/s5500_52g3-cmw520-r1109.bin
日志文件:如果 logfile
目录下的文件(如 .log
文件)很大且不再需要,可以删除。
# 进入logfile目录
cd logfile
# 删除所有日志文件
reset logfile
无用的备份文件:确认一些以 .cfg
为后缀的备份配置文件是否还需要,不需要可以删除。
绝对不能删除的文件:
当前启动的系统软件文件(即 boot-loader
命令指定的文件)。
当前的启动配置文件 startup.cfg
(有时可能是 config.cfg
)。
license
文件(如果有的话)。
79%的占用是正常的,无需过分担心,这不会影响交换机的转发性能。
建议定期(如每半年或一年)通过 dir
命令查看FLASH使用情况。
如果占用率超过90%,可以按照上述方法清理旧的系统文件和日志文件来释放空间。
核心原则是:只删除你确认不再需要的文件,不确定的文件不要动。
通过简单的维护,您的S5500G3交换机完全可以长期稳定地工作。
亲~登录后才可以操作哦!
确定你的邮箱还未认证,请认证邮箱或绑定手机后进行当前操作
举报
×
侵犯我的权益
×
侵犯了我企业的权益
×
抄袭了我的内容
×
原文链接或出处
诽谤我
×
对根叔社区有害的内容
×
不规范转载
×
举报说明
暂无评论